True, but that's not what's being asked here. If multiple URLs could
serve requests for a single repository---i.e., if you've got both 
deb http://ftp1.CC.debian.org/debian unstable main
and
deb http://ftp2.CC.debian.org/debian unstable main
in your sources.list, then apt will download everything from
ftp1.CC.debian.org (bar those files it gets an error on at that server;
in that case, it will download them from the second server).

Which is, indeed, silly.
